Формат относится к спецификации РПГУ.
Запрос
Адрес запроса
GET: {{url}}/api/v2/iemk/personal |
Заголовки запроса
Заголовок | Значение (тип/формат значения) | Описание | Обязательный |
---|---|---|---|
Authorization | Bearer {rpguToken} (без скобок и через пробел после Bearer) | RPGU токен, полученный с помощью сервиса авторизации | + |
Ответ сервера
В случае успешного выполнения сервер вернет ответ в формате JSON со следующими данными:
Название | Тип данных | Описание | Комментарий |
---|---|---|---|
Doctor | Doctor | Информация о враче прикрепления | null, в случае если не указан Участковый врач |
Lpu | Array of LpuItem | Список ЛПУ, в которых есть карта пациента | |
Area | Area | Информация об участке прикрепления | Участки ищутся по алгоритму описанному в Поиск пациента в МИП |
PersonGuid | Guid | Идентификатор пациента в МИП |
Описание Doctor
Название | Тип данных | Описание | Комментарий |
---|---|---|---|
Id | string | Идентификатор врача | Склейка гуида ЛПУ и гуида ресурса |
Lpu_Code | string | Идентификатор ЛПУ врача | |
Name | string | Имя врача | |
Lastname | string | Отчество врача | |
Surname | string | Фамилия врача | |
Position | string | Должность врача | |
Department_id | string | Код специальности врача | |
Room | string | Кабинет | |
Lpu_name | string | Наименование ЛПУ врача | |
Lpu_address | string | Адрес ЛПУ | |
Phone | string | Номер телефона |
Описание Area
Название | Тип данных | Описание | Комментарий |
---|---|---|---|
Name | string | Наименование участка | |
Number | string | Номер участка | |
Type | string | Тип участка | Из oms_kl_TypeU.Name |
Возможные ошибки
Код ответа сервера | Код сообщения | Сообщение | Тип ошибки |
---|---|---|---|
403 | 5010 | Запрос должен содержать 'Authorization: Bearer ...' | Error |
403 | 5008 | Токен некорректен | Error |
403 | 5007 | Время действия токена истекло | Error |
В случае возникновения ошибок будет возвращен стандартный ответ сервера.